The Trons: self-playing robot band totally kills our self-esteem

Darren Murph

We'll admit, we reckoned we were coming along alright with our bar chords, but now we're teetering on the edge of just giving up. Yeah, we've seen robotic mechanisms programmed to make meaningful sounds before, but The Trons are a bona fide band, man. We hear they're going on tour as well -- talk about a guaranteed sell out. Totally killer Sister Robot video after the jump.

